务必先安装或者导入moment.js
let early_year = parseInt(moment(res.data.early_month).format('YYYY'))
let early_month = parseInt(moment(res.data.early_month).format('MM'))
let timeNow = new Date()
var allDate = []
console.log(timeNow.getFullYear(),timeNow.getMonth()+1) // 现在日期(年月)
console.log(early_year,early_month) // 起始日期(年月)
// 2019-1
for(let i=0; i<timeNow.getFullYear()-early_year+1; i++){
allDate.push({
year: early_year + i,
month: []
})
while(early_month <= 12){
allDate[i].month.push(early_month)
early_month++
if(allDate[i].year == timeNow.getFullYear() && early_month > timeNow.getMonth()+1){
break
}
}
early_month = 1
}